Kia India celebrated a momentous occasion as it reached a significant milestone of dispatching one million vehicles from its manufacturing facility in Anantapur. The milestone also marked the rollout of the first unit of their latest SUV, the new Seltos facelift 2023.
Kia Seltos Facelift 2023 Becomes Company's One Millionth Vehicle
At a unique event conducted at its global facility in Anantapur, Kia India celebrated the production of 1 million units. The New Seltos' introduction as the one-millionth vehicle served as the event's high point.
The event was attended by Buggana Rajendranath Reddy, Minister of Finance, Planning, and Legislative Affairs, Gudivada Amarnath, Minister of Industries, Infrastructure, Investment and Commerce, and Information Technology, Gorantla Madhav, and G Sankaranarayana, Member of the Legislative Assembly from Penukonda.

Kia’s Biggest Manufacturing Plant In India
The state-of-the-art manufacturing facility in Anantapur has played a pivotal role in Kia's success, producing over 532,450 units of the Seltos (including both outgoing and incoming models), 332,450 units of the Sonet, 120,516 units of the Carens, and 14,584 units of the Carnival, said the company in a statement.
Kia’s Entry In India
With the launch of the Seltos in August 2019, Kia made its entry into the Indian market. The SUV enthusiast community welcomed the Seltos instantly. Kia reached the incredible milestone of 500,000 sales in a timeframe of 46 months. Kia strengthened their position in India by expanding their product line by releasing the Carnival and Sonet in 2020, followed by the Carens and EV6 in 2022.
